Output 8190d52bd82c56b7d2e5a93b7a546e846aee38669253abe49cacc25f284ee45d:3

value
510864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95bdea1b697582480ee2749ed8c66c277fc11cd OP_EQUAL
address
3L3hoKMLPn1e8tYWPPHo86NLcERwQcvVoE
transaction
8190d52bd82c56b7d2e5a93b7a546e846aee38669253abe49cacc25f284ee45d
spent
true